当前位置:纸飞机TG > 谷歌浏览器教程 > 文章页

浏览器内核开发教程_浏览器内核设置在哪里?:《深入浅出浏览器内核开发实战教程》

发布时间:2024-03-11 23:11  分类: 谷歌浏览器教程

浏览器内核开发教程_浏览器内核设置在哪里?:《深入浅出浏览器内核开发实战教程》

随着互联网的快速发展,浏览器已经成为我们日常生活中不可或缺的工具。浏览器内核作为浏览器的核心,负责解析网页、渲染页面等关键功能。深入了解浏览器内核的开发,对于前端开发者来说具有重要意义。本文将为您介绍浏览器内核开发的实战教程,并解答浏览器内核设置在哪里?这一疑问。

什么是浏览器内核

浏览器内核,也称为渲染引擎,是浏览器中负责解析HTML、CSS和JavaScript等网页内容的模块。不同的浏览器内核有不同的特点,如Chrome的Blink内核、Firefox的Gecko内核、Safari的WebKit内核等。内核的性能和兼容性直接影响到浏览器的用户体验。

浏览器内核开发的重要性

随着前端技术的发展,浏览器内核的开发变得越来越重要。掌握内核开发,可以帮助开发者更好地理解网页渲染过程,优化网页性能,提高用户体验。内核开发还可以帮助开发者解决跨浏览器兼容性问题,提高代码的可维护性。

浏览器内核设置在哪里

浏览器内核的设置通常在浏览器的配置文件中。以下是一些常见浏览器的内核设置方法:

- Chrome浏览器:Chrome浏览器的内核设置可以通过命令行参数来调整。例如,可以通过`--disable-gpu`来禁用GPU加速。

- Firefox浏览器:Firefox浏览器的内核设置可以在关于:配置页面中找到。例如,可以通过`layout.css.devmode`来开启开发者模式。

- Safari浏览器:Safari浏览器的内核设置可以通过系统偏好设置中的安全与隐私选项进行调整。

浏览器内核开发实战教程

以下是一个简单的浏览器内核开发实战教程,帮助您了解内核开发的基本流程:

1. 了解内核架构:需要了解您所选择的浏览器内核的架构和原理。

2. 搭建开发环境:根据内核的文档,搭建相应的开发环境,包括编译器、调试工具等。

3. 编写代码:根据需求编写内核代码,实现特定的功能。

4. 调试与测试:使用调试工具对代码进行调试,确保代码的正确性和性能。

5. 性能优化:对内核代码进行性能优化,提高浏览器的运行效率。

6. 提交代码:将代码提交到内核的代码库,与其他开发者协作。

浏览器内核开发工具

在进行浏览器内核开发时,以下是一些常用的工具:

- Git:用于代码版本控制和协作开发。

- Clang/GCC:用于编译内核代码。

- GDB:用于调试内核代码。

- Valgrind:用于性能分析和内存泄漏检测。

浏览器内核开发是一个复杂且富有挑战性的领域。您应该对浏览器内核有了更深入的了解,并掌握了内核设置的基本方法。希望本文能帮助您在浏览器内核开发的道路上迈出坚实的一步。

相关阅读:

夸克浏览器怎么返回上一页;夸克浏览器返回主页:夸克浏览器轻松返回,一键回溯历史页面

苹果系统重装mac系统、苹果系统重装mac系统长按 command+R 无反应:轻松重装Mac系统,苹果焕新体验

谷歌打不开数据库网页,谷歌打不开数据库网页无法访问:谷歌数据库网页打不开,紧急排查中

ipadsafari清除不了数据-ipad清除所有数据还有残留吗:iPad Safari清除不掉数据?揭秘解决之道

chromeos对比fydeos哪个好、chromeos和安卓的区别:ChromeOS与FydeOS:谁更胜一筹?

edge浏览器chrome内核(edge用chrome内核:探索未来,Edge浏览器引领Chrome内核新篇章)

谷歌翻译如何翻译成中文、谷歌翻译怎么翻译:谷歌翻译中文技巧揭秘

谷歌浏览器怎样建桌面快捷方式;谷歌浏览器如何添加桌面快捷方式:谷歌浏览器轻松建桌面快捷方式教程

mac停用自动登录后还要输入密码-mac停用请60分钟后再试:mac停用自动登录,密码输入成新常态

谷歌浏览器快捷图标文字看不清;谷歌浏览器快捷图标文字看不清怎么回事:谷歌浏览器快捷图标文字模糊不清,如何解决?

版权申明:本文出自

转载请保留出处和本文地址:https://zfjtg.net/chrome/45477.html

上一篇:浏览器内核解析、浏览器内核解析错误:揭秘浏览器内核解析奥秘 下一篇:浏览器内核开源_开源的浏览器内核:探索浏览器内核开源奥秘之旅